Who is the Caramelo Dog in Brazil

Caramelo Dog in Brazil refers to a caramel-coloured dog breed that is considered a recognisable representation of a Brazilian street dog. The simplicity of this character makes it convenient to use in a game, as it is easy to associate with notions like motion, luck, survival, and adventure.

It stems from the cultural characteristics of this kind of animal. First of all, it is important to note that the dog in question does not represent a refined mascot. On the contrary, this character can be perceived in the context of an ordinary life – being sociable, adaptable, independent, and ubiquitous.

In Caramelo Dog: Lucky Run, Evoplay implements this cultural stereotype through the character Taco, a caramel-coloured playmate with friendly eyes and a fearless soul. This character has his objective – he got lost and wants to get back home through the bustling neighbourhood.

Caramelo Sortudo

Caramelo Sortudo is the slot with the Caramelo theme, a 27 Ways payout scheme, and the Grilled Chicken Bonus. The indicated Return to Player of this machine is 96.00%, and the maximum win amount is x810.

It is structured like a typical slot machine – the player places a bet and starts the spin. As the title has a 27 Ways mechanic, it offers more possibilities than payline slots. However, the main player’s actions stay passive. There is one additional theme-related element – the Grilled Chicken Bonus. It adds some thematic value and elevates the feature’s level. Nonetheless, the player does not control the dog during the bonus.

Lucky Caramelo Tada

Lucky Caramelo Tada is another slot-like game that also relies on the Caramelo concept. It is appealing due to its colourful dog-themed design and bonuses that align with this fun identity. Here, the player has slot-like gameplay mechanics that involve spinning and waiting for the result. While bonuses may be included to make the process more interesting, nothing changes when we speak about the essence – symbols come into position and are evaluated by the system.

That is why it is easier to consider Lucky Caramelo Tada a typical casino game rather than a step multiplier. There is a cute dog, but no player-controlled travel, route selection, or decisions after successful steps.

O Vira-Lata Caramelo

O Vira-Lata Caramelo is a slot machine with an RTP of 96.50%, a maximum win of x5,000, and a pay-anywhere feature. The reason this kind of slot deviates from a payline slot is that, in some cases, winnings can be created either by way of symbol counting or via clusters.

The pay-anywhere feature creates a more modern rhythm compared to a regular line-based slot. The pay-anywhere mechanism can offer additional dynamics in terms of screen outcomes. But the player's action is still restricted after the spinning starts. In contrast to Caramelo Dog Lucky Run, O Vira-Lata Caramelo is also a slot game, although it features the Caramelo name and the reel-based gameplay.

From Slots To Instant Gameplay

Caramelo Sortudo, Lucky Caramelo Tada, and O Vira-Lata Caramelo are examples of slot machines that use reels, paylines, ways, or a pay-anywhere mechanism. Here, the user's actions consist of hitting the spin button, and further, the outcome of the event is determined by the game's reel or symbol engine. On the contrary, Caramelo Dog Lucky Run casino game employs an instant. It has no reels, no paylines, and no spin cycle. The player places the bet, selects the difficulty, initiates the game, and performs actions during the session.

These differences change the pace of the game. The slot spin ends when the reels stop. The result of Caramelo Dog: Lucky Run becomes gradually clear. Successful moves increase the multiplier, and each step increases the player's risk. The mechanics become similar to the mechanics of step multipliers. The player does not determine the game's outcome, but determines when the game will be stopped.

Decisions instead of spins

The process in slot games is rather simple: make a bet, spin, and wait for the outcome. The bonus rounds, if any, can complicate things, but the main process will always remain passive during the spinning stage. The process for Caramelo Dog: Lucky Run is different: act, make a decision to continue or quit, and proceed accordingly. After Taco gets stuck, the player can collect the winnings or continue moving to earn higher multipliers.

It is the decision-making process within the round that makes this title stand out from other Caramelo slots. Not only is there an inquiry, "What result would the spin give?", but also "Does it pay off to move on?" The cash-out option provides an answer. After Taco is stopped, the player can cash out and stop at any point in the round. However, continued movement increases the reward, but a crash ends the round.

Four difficulty statuses

There are four different difficulty settings in Caramelo Dog Lucky Run. These settings are named Easy, Medium, Hard, and Hardcore. Each of them determines the obstacle intensity, the crash risk, and the starting multiplier. Traditionally, slot games change little from a single spin to the next. A player can change the amount of money he puts at stake, but the risk model remains essentially the same. Caramelo Dog Lucky Run allows the player to determine their level of risk before the run.

Easy setting is the least risky one and provides control over the game. This is a perfect choice for the player who wishes to learn the CrossyRun™ mechanic and start at a moderate pace. Medium provides a balance between the two other settings. Hard setting adds intensity and offers a bigger multiplier. The hardcore setting is the most risky, offering the highest multiplier and the greatest risk of losing.
